This article provides a summary of Circle STARKs, a novel advancement that improves the efficiency of traditional STARKs by enabling efficient operations over non-smooth fields, specifically leveraging the computational advantages of Mersenne primes. Here, we unveil how Circle STARKs overcome key limitations in traditional STARK protocols, offering new possibilities for performance optimization: http://zkm.io/blog/traditional-stark-vs-circle-stark

We have selected the first 'featured article' of our Contributor Corner, and the honour goes to 'Emzo' for his work 'The Fiat-Shamir Transformation: Enabling Non-Interactive Proofs': http://zkm.io/education-hub/contribution/featured-articles Emzo provides a light introduction to the Fiat-Shamir heuristic, a key cryptographic method that converts multi-round interactive proof systems into non-interactive protocols secured by cryptographic hash functions 🤝

From a development perspective, if the program is just a SHA2, consisting solely of logic operations, and is easy to implement, custom ZK is definitely more efficient than zkVM. However, when dealing with zkML for instance, which involves complex computations like floating-point arithmetic, non-linear functions, and elliptic curve pairing, custom ZK might not be as efficient. zkVM can leverage continuation and proof aggregation to parallelize proof generation, significantly speeding up the process. Thus, efficiency should be defined in terms of both build time and run time; focusing solely on run time is insufficient. For example, before computers, we used calculators, which were faster for simple math problems. But with general-purpose computers, we can perform much more complex calculations far more quickly. Both are efficient in different scenarios, which is why we use both calculators and computers today. https://x.com/vanishree_rao/status/1817617950624698782
